Yes, comfrey is very nice. I lament the loss of my plants :(
One should be careful in consuming it. Some studies have shown that prolonged use can cause liver damage. Thus it is usually used externally, rather than internally. Lady's fingers are very valuable for the treatment of sore throat and persistent dry cough because it is rich in mucilage and acts as a medicine to relieve the irritation, swelling and pain. Ginger is another natural anti-viral herbs that reduces pain and fever and a mild sedative effect, which contributes to a rest.
